Tyre Dealers in Yarm

Derek Campbell

Tyre Dealers
Lockheed Close Preston Farm Industrial Estate, Stockton On Tees, TS18 3SE

10 / 10

from 7 reviews

Tyre Exchange

Tyre Dealers
Unit 2a Opus Park Lockheed Close, Stockton On Tees, TS18 3BP